There are different kinds of scholarships available such as merit-based, need-based, government, and private scholarships. Students can apply for these based on their marks, family income, or special achievements.
Merit-Based Scholarships:
These are given to students who have high marks in their previous exams, like Class 12 or graduation. For example, students with more than 85% marks can get up to 70% fee waiver on tuition fees.
Need-Based Scholarships:
These are for students who come from low-income families and may find it hard to pay full fees. Students have to show income certificates and other documents to apply.
Government Scholarships:
Poornima University also helps students apply for scholarships offered by the Central and State Governments, like:
Post Matric Scholarship (for SC/ST/OBC students)
Minority Welfare Scholarships
National Scholarship Portal (NSP) Schemes
Private & Corporate Scholarships:
Some private companies and trusts offer scholarships for selected students at Poornima University. These are often for students studying in Engineering, Management, or Technology fields.
The eligibility for each scholarship is different, but in general:
For merit scholarships, students must have 70% to 90% or above in their qualifying exams (Class 10+2 for UG, graduation for PG).
For need-based scholarships, students should have a valid income certificate showing annual family income less than ₹2.5–5 lakh.
Category-based (SC/ST/OBC/minority) students must provide their valid caste or community certificate.
For government schemes, students must register on the NSP portal and fulfill the required conditions like attendance, bank account in their name, Aadhaar number, etc.
Students can apply for scholarships in the following simple steps:
During the admission process, tick the box for “scholarship request” in the main application form or collect the separate scholarship form from the university office.
Attach required documents such as marksheets, income certificate, caste certificate, ID proof, and passport-size photos.
The university will verify the documents and eligibility. Some scholarships may require interviews or counseling sessions.
If approved, the scholarship amount is adjusted from the tuition fee and the final payable fee is reduced.
For government scholarships, students must apply through scholarships.gov.in or the state portal by uploading all details and documents online.
Most scholarships are valid for one academic year and must be renewed yearly.
To renew the scholarship, students must:
Maintain a minimum percentage (usually 60–75%)
Have good attendance (usually 75% or more)
Not be involved in disciplinary actions
Renewal forms are usually filled before the start of the new academic session.
Scholarship Name | Eligibility | Benefits | Application Process |
---|---|---|---|
Merit-Based Scholarship | 85%+ in Class 12 or Graduation | 30% to 70% tuition fee waiver | Apply during admission + upload marksheets |
Need-Based Scholarship | Family income < ₹2.5–5 lakh/year | 20% to 50% tuition fee relief | Income proof submission at university office |
Post Matric Scholarship (SC/ST/OBC) | Belong to SC/ST/OBC category + income criteria | As per govt. rules (full/partial fee) | Apply on NSP / State portal + submit documents |
Minority Welfare Scheme | Muslim, Sikh, Christian, Buddhist, Jain | ₹10,000–₹25,000 yearly | Register on NSP + submit community certificate |
Corporate Sponsored Scholarships | Top performers in tech/business courses | ₹20,000–₹50,000 (one-time/annual) | Apply via university or sponsor-specific process |
